How can companies effectively incorporate customer feedback into their strategy to enhance their customer-centric culture, and what methods can they use to gather and analyze this feedback in a timely manner?
Companies can effectively incorporate customer feedback into their strategy by establishing a systematic process for collecting and analyzing feedback through surveys, focus groups, and social media monitoring. They can also create a feedback loop by actively listening to customer concerns, addressing issues promptly, and communicating changes based on feedback. Utilizing customer relationship management (CRM) software can help companies gather and analyze feedback in a timely manner by organizing and tracking customer interactions, preferences, and feedback data. Additionally, companies can leverage data analytics tools to identify trends, patterns, and opportunities for improvement based on customer feedback.
